static void messageHandlerInMainThread(v8::Local<v8::Message> message, v8::Local<v8::Value> data)
{
    ASSERT(isMainThread());
    v8::Isolate* isolate = v8::Isolate::GetCurrent();

    if (isolate->GetEnteredContext().IsEmpty())
        return;

    // If called during context initialization, there will be no entered context.
    ScriptState* scriptState = ScriptState::current(isolate);
    if (!scriptState->contextIsValid())
        return;

    ExecutionContext* context = scriptState->getExecutionContext();
    std::unique_ptr<SourceLocation> location = SourceLocation::fromMessage(isolate, message, context);

    AccessControlStatus accessControlStatus = NotSharableCrossOrigin;
    if (message->IsOpaque())
        accessControlStatus = OpaqueResource;
    else if (message->IsSharedCrossOrigin())
        accessControlStatus = SharableCrossOrigin;

    ErrorEvent* event = ErrorEvent::create(toCoreStringWithNullCheck(message->Get()), std::move(location), &scriptState->world());

    String messageForConsole = extractMessageForConsole(isolate, data);
    if (!messageForConsole.isEmpty())
        event->setUnsanitizedMessage("Uncaught " + messageForConsole);

    // This method might be called while we're creating a new context. In this case, we
    // avoid storing the exception object, as we can't create a wrapper during context creation.
    // FIXME: Can we even get here during initialization now that we bail out when GetEntered returns an empty handle?
    if (context->isDocument()) {
        LocalFrame* frame = toDocument(context)->frame();
        if (frame && frame->script().existingWindowProxy(scriptState->world())) {
            V8ErrorHandler::storeExceptionOnErrorEventWrapper(scriptState, event, data, scriptState->context()->Global());
        }
    }

    if (scriptState->world().isPrivateScriptIsolatedWorld()) {
        // We allow a private script to dispatch error events even in a EventDispatchForbiddenScope scope.
        // Without having this ability, it's hard to debug the private script because syntax errors
        // in the private script are not reported to console (the private script just crashes silently).
        // Allowing error events in private scripts is safe because error events don't propagate to
        // other isolated worlds (which means that the error events won't fire any event listeners
        // in user's scripts).
        EventDispatchForbiddenScope::AllowUserAgentEvents allowUserAgentEvents;
        context->reportException(event, accessControlStatus);
    } else {
        context->reportException(event, accessControlStatus);
    }
}
